Hlavní navigace

Názor k článku Už i v Africe docházejí IPv4 adresy od Z - Vašeho nejčernějšího scénáře bych se nebál. Nevyjde to...

  • Článek je starý, nové názory již nelze přidávat.
  • 31. 3. 2017 11:55

    Z (neregistrovaný) ---.sattnet.cz

    Vašeho nejčernějšího scénáře bych se nebál. Nevyjde to tak strašně, jak by se mohlo zdát, jen je potřeba napsat implementaci BGP efektivněji.
    Když si to jen tak od boku spočítám: velikost /32 rozsahu je 2^32. To znamená, že by si páteřní router musel držet 2^32 záznamů. Počítám, že by mu ke každému stačilo držet si čtyři bajty informace (nepředpokládám, že by to v páteři forwardovalo na více než 256^2 serverů, a řekl bych, že si BGP vystačí s dvěma bajty na uložení zbytku informací (počet hopů a třeba ještě něco dalšího).
    2^32 * 4 bajty = 1024*1024*1024*4*4 = 16GB. Neboli i na vyřešení nejhoršího scénáře stačí routeru přikoupit 16GB RAM v rámci kterých bude server schopen určit, kam packet forwardovat na jeden dotaz do paměti. (protože přirozeně nebude těch 2^32 záznamů procházet sekvenčně, ale přímým skokem na správné místo v paměti.)
    To mi nepřipadá tak hrozné. Po síti se ta data podle mě moc tahat nebudou, protože ty IP adresy se nepřesunují tak rychle, první start proběhne jen jedinkrát. Potom už se celá směrovací tabulka dá cacheovat na disk... Navíc mezi BGP routery jsou celkem slušné linky, takže ani přelít pár giga dat není oproti dřívější době problém atd.